How much does it cost to replace a wood deck with composite?
Decking Material Costs
Cedar Deck Boards Between $3 to $6 per square foot. Redwood Deck Boards Between $10 to $15 per square foot. Ipe Deck Boards Between $10 to $20 per square foot. Composite Deck Boards Between $12 to $22 per square foot.

Perhaps essentially the most-trumpeted benefit of composite wood decking is the fact that it requires very little maintenance. Timber decking must be treated every couple of years to keep it from changing into unpleasant and – ultimately – unusable. Composite deck boards, then again, don’t have to be stained or painted, and in contrast to timber boards, they’re not vulnerable to rotting, warping and splintering.
All you need to do is purchase your new decking and it will deal with itself. In addition to this, you received’t need to re-varnish it yearly. This can solely be a good thing because it means you’ll have fewer supplies to purchase.
How do you maintain composite decking?
Spray deck with soap, then follow by gently scrubbing each deck board with a soft bristle brush. Spray/rinse each individual deck board using a fan tip no closer than 8" from the decking surface. RINSE THOROUGHLY. If dirty water from cleaning is left to dry, this will cause a film to remain on the decking surface.

What are the problems with composite decking?
Stains: One of the most common complaints about composite decking is mold. Decking that is in shaded area or areas that tend to get wet frequently have been shown to grow mold and stain the deck. This is not restricted to composite decking. Wood decking can grow mold, mildew and algae.
